DSX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2022 in Review

91 of the 5,805 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Diana Shipping (DSX) for Q3 2022, worth a combined $46.7M — down 35% from $72M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 26 funds closed out of DSX and 19 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 31 trimmed existing stakes and 26 added.

The largest buyer was Winton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$418K. The largest seller was Hosking Partners, cutting an estimated $4.49M.
